About Michele Borba, Ed.D.
Michele Borba, Ed.D., author of 19 books on parenting, character educations and self-esteem including Building Moral Intelligence and No More Misbehavin, 38 Difficult Behaviors and How to Stop Them, has worked with more than half a million parents and teachers over the course of more than two decades. A dynamic and highly sought-after speaker, she has presented hundreds of keynote addresses and workshops throughout North America, Europe, Asia and the South Pacific on enhancing children’s self-esteem, achievement, and behavior. Her down-to-earth speaking style, inspirational stories, and practical strategies and solution-based ideas appeal to audiences worldwide.
Dr. Borba 1999 book Parents Do Make A Difference was selected by Child Magazine as one of the most outstanding parenting books of the year. Her Esteem Builders has been used by over 1,500,000 students worldwide and was quoted by Newsweek as one of the most widely-used self-esteem curriculums over the past two decades. Dr. Borba is also a contributing writer to Chicken Soup for the Soul and has been featured in Newsweek, Family Circle, Child Magazine, Parents Magazine, Working Mother, Family Life, Personal Excellence, First for Women, Redbook, and LA Times.
As a recognized expert on parenting and self-esteem, Dr. Borba has been a frequent guest on television and NPR radio talk shows throughout North America including ABC's The View, ABC's Home Show, Fox Channel’s The Parent Table, Family Talk, Turning Point, To Your Health, The Parent’s Journal, Canadian Parent Report, ETN, and Success Radio and served as a expert source to ABC 20/20, Arnold Shapiro Productions, and Sunburst documentaries on self-esteem. Her numerous awards include the National Educator Award, presented by the National Council of Self-Esteem; Santa Clara University’s Outstanding Alumna Award; and the award for Outstanding Contribution to the Educational Profession, presented by the Bureau of Education and Research. She has recently been named the Honorary chairperson for the Implementation of Self-Esteem in Hong Kong.
Dr. Borba was formerly a classroom and college teacher and has had a wide range of teaching experience, including work in regular education as well as work with children with learning disabilities; children with physical, behavioral, and emotional disabilities; and gifted children. She and her husband were partners in a private practice for troubled children and adolescents in Campbell, California. She received her doctorate in educational psychology and counseling from the University of San Francisco, her M.A. in learning disabilities, and her B.A. from the University of Santa Clara; she earned a life teaching credential from San Jose State University. She currently lives in Palm Springs, California, with her husband and three teenage sons.
